从PHP脚本发送500内部服务器错误错误,可以通过以下步骤实现:
- 确定错误类型:500内部服务器错误是一种常见的服务器端错误,通常表示服务器在处理请求时遇到了问题。这种错误可能是由于代码错误、服务器配置问题或者资源限制等引起的。
- 检查PHP代码:首先,检查PHP脚本中是否存在语法错误、逻辑错误或者其他错误。可以使用调试工具、日志记录或者错误报告来帮助定位问题。确保代码中没有明显的错误。
- 检查服务器配置:检查服务器的配置文件,例如php.ini文件,确保配置正确并且没有限制了脚本的执行时间、内存限制等。可以根据具体情况进行调整。
- 错误处理和日志记录:在PHP脚本中添加错误处理机制,例如使用try-catch语句捕获异常,并将错误信息记录到日志文件中。这样可以帮助定位问题并进行排查。
- 调试工具和日志分析:使用调试工具和日志分析工具来帮助定位问题。例如,可以使用Xdebug、Firebug等工具进行代码调试,或者使用日志分析工具来查看服务器日志和错误日志。
- 优化代码和性能:如果代码运行缓慢或者存在性能问题,可以进行代码优化和性能调优。例如,使用缓存、优化数据库查询、减少网络请求等方式来提高代码执行效率。
- 监控和报警:设置监控和报警机制,及时发现和解决服务器错误。可以使用监控工具来监控服务器的性能指标、错误日志等,当出现问题时及时通知相关人员。
腾讯云相关产品和产品介绍链接地址: